Sep. 25-26, 2010
Chesterfield

Two well-known St. Louis County traditions are combined: the Tilles Fine Arts Festival, at the St. Louis Carousel area in Faust Park; and the Faust Folk Festival. Hop on a hay-wagon for a free ride to the Historic Village entrance. The festival features tours, demonstrations of blacksmithing, rope making, pottery firing and other historical arts and crafts. In addition, enjoy a first rate juried fine arts sale featuring artists with their original work. There are live music, food vendors and children’s activities.

Admission:$5; younger than 5, free; includes both events and a ride on the St. Louis Carousel.

1050 S. Riverside Drive
St. Charles 63301

Educational facility has exhibits on the Lewis and Clark Expedition and the Missouri River ecosystem. Something for all ages. Full-size replicas of the keelboat and pirogues used by Lewis and Clark. There is a bookstore and gift shop. School field trips and bus tours are welcome. Admission: $4; ages 3-16, $2.
